I wanted a stock-appearing 1 3/4" exhaust that still flowed reasonably
well. I had a system built around this Dynomax turbo muffler below. The
lightly breathed-on 289 in this car puts out a very friendly 255 HP at
the rear wheels, and the exhaust has just enough bark to be enjoyable
without rattling the neighbor's windows.


http://store.summitracing.com/partdetail.asp?autofilter=1&part=WLK%2D177
71&N=700+4294923429+4294922711+4294922710+400358+115&autoview=sku

Most good exhaust shops can fab up anything you need, I had them make
and weld the rear hanger straps, then I painted them myself with
high-temp paint before they assembled the system. Total cost was around
$350.
